我正在开发一个烧瓶应用程序。我已经决定使用 Flask-Security 来实现它的许多强大功能。但是,除了他们在此处提供的 QuickStart 之外,我很难找到工作代码的示例。具体来说,我需要从我知道 Flask-Security 使用的 Flask-Login 插件访问登录管理器。这是否意味着我需要从 Flask-Security 导入 Login-Manager?访问它的最佳方式是什么?
谢谢您的帮助!
我正在开发一个烧瓶应用程序。我已经决定使用 Flask-Security 来实现它的许多强大功能。但是,除了他们在此处提供的 QuickStart 之外,我很难找到工作代码的示例。具体来说,我需要从我知道 Flask-Security 使用的 Flask-Login 插件访问登录管理器。这是否意味着我需要从 Flask-Security 导入 Login-Manager?访问它的最佳方式是什么?
谢谢您的帮助!
据我所知,您可以通过以下方式访问登录管理器:
current_app.login_manager
从我在 Flask-Security 文档 ( http://pythonhosted.org/Flask-Security/api.html ) 中看到的示例来看,它可能响应了该模块文档中的原生 Flask-Login 方法:
https://flask-login.readthedocs.org/en/latest/#api-documentation
我自己刚刚开始修补 Flask-Security,并且对缺少示例和文档感到恼火,如果这没有帮助,请原谅我 ><